Michigan’s Move Over law is going into high gear this Monday, with state police launching a statewide crackdown between 11 a.m. and 4 p.m. Drivers must shift over a lane when safe, or slow down at least 10 mph and proceed with extreme caution when encountering flashing lights from emergency vehicles. This isn’t just about fines—it’s about saving lives: 13 patrol cars have been struck this year, and seven troopers have died on the roadside.
